Special Exhibit at the St. Catharines Museum
Cabin Fever: Winter in St. Catharines
November 19, 2011 to March 25, 2012

Special in-house exhibit featuring items from our Collections show how people in St. Catharines survived the often harsh winter conditions. Investigate an interactive Depression-era kitchen, showcasing an ACE metal ice box, a pantry filled with winter necessities and a 1924 Locomotive washer, as well as a 1970’s living room where they can tune into the 1971 Memorial Cup final hockey game on a 1965 RCA Victor “New Vista” television. Visitors may also build a snow fort and decorate a snowman.
